@High4Times20 JDM FD2 have 225 bhp in Type-R vesion, Mugen RR have 245 bhp, and Mugen RR tuned have 2.2 K20A 265 bhp. All these cars are stock, and you can buy it. DC2 is great car and it's fast as hell mostly because is lower from stock, lighter and have very good suspensions from stock. JDM DC5 Integra also in Type-R version have 225 bhp. Other DC5's ITR's have 200 bhp in EU, US.
@High4Times20 There's several version of K20, from 200 bhp (US, EU, UK), to JDM K20 (225, 245, stroked 265 bhp). K series are very good, 4 times voted for best engine of the year. Alo more powerful K20 versions are called Frankenstein K24, and biggest K24 stroker 2.6 tuned by ALL MOTOR (Team 1320).

It's not just the handling but the B-series are just an overall superior motor than the H-series. Also ITRs were rated 1 in some things and preludes in the other. Not bashing on preludes, but if you have the money ITR>prelude, if not GSRs or B-swapped civics are great. H22's aren't as reliable and don't take boost well, are heavier and don't have as much clearance.
